    Why the Honda Civic Genio Still Rocks

    The Honda Civic Genio, produced in the 1990s, holds a special place in the hearts of many car enthusiasts. Its sleek design, reliable engine, and affordable price made it a hit back then, and it continues to be a popular choice in the used car market today. In Surabaya, finding a Honda Civic Genio bekas is relatively easy, but finding a good one requires some knowledge and patience. The Genio offers a unique blend of classic styling and practicality that's hard to find in newer cars, especially at its price point. One of the main reasons why the Genio remains a favorite is its fuel efficiency. The 1.6-liter engine is known for providing a good balance between power and economy, making it an ideal choice for city driving in Surabaya. Plus, the Genio is relatively easy to maintain, with plenty of spare parts available and a community of mechanics who know the car inside and out. Another appealing aspect is its simplicity. Unlike modern cars loaded with complex electronics, the Genio is straightforward and easier to repair, which can save you money on maintenance in the long run. However, keep in mind that these cars are getting older, so a thorough inspection is crucial before making a purchase. Checking for rust, engine condition, and the overall maintenance history is essential. Many Genio owners have also customized their cars, so you might find some with aftermarket modifications. While some modifications can enhance the car's performance and appearance, others might indicate that the car has been driven hard or not maintained properly. So, it’s important to evaluate any modifications carefully and consider their impact on the car's reliability and value.     What to Look for When Buying a Used Genio in Surabaya

    When you're in Surabaya and ready to hunt for that perfect Honda Civic Genio bekas, you need to arm yourself with some essential knowledge. Finding a good used car isn't just about spotting a shiny exterior; it's about digging deep to ensure you're getting a reliable vehicle. So, what are the key things to keep an eye on? First and foremost, inspect the body for rust. Surabaya's humid climate can be tough on cars, and rust is a common problem, especially in older vehicles like the Genio. Pay close attention to the wheel wells, rocker panels, and undercarriage. Any signs of bubbling paint or visible rust could indicate more extensive corrosion beneath the surface. Next, check the engine. Listen for any unusual noises, such as knocking or ticking, when the engine is running. Also, look for any leaks or signs of oil around the engine bay. A well-maintained engine should run smoothly and quietly. Don't forget to examine the exhaust. Blue smoke could indicate burning oil, while black smoke might suggest a problem with the fuel mixture. These issues can be costly to repair, so it's best to identify them before you buy. Test drive the car thoroughly. Pay attention to how it handles, accelerates, and brakes. Check the suspension by driving over bumps and listening for any unusual sounds. Make sure the car shifts smoothly through all the gears. Also, inspect the interior. Look for signs of wear and tear, such as torn seats or a cracked dashboard. Check that all the electrical components, like the lights, wipers, and air conditioning, are working properly. A neglected interior could be a sign that the car hasn't been well-maintained overall. Another crucial step is to check the car's paperwork. Make sure the registration and ownership documents are in order. Verify that the VIN (Vehicle Identification Number) on the car matches the VIN on the documents. This can help you avoid buying a stolen or illegally modified vehicle. It's also a good idea to ask for the car's maintenance history. Regular maintenance is key to keeping a car running smoothly, so a car with a complete service record is usually a better bet. If the seller can't provide any documentation, that could be a red flag. Finally, consider getting a pre-purchase inspection from a trusted mechanic. A professional can identify any hidden problems that you might miss. This small investment could save you a lot of money and headaches in the long run.     Common Problems and How to Address Them

    Even the most reliable cars can have their quirks, and the Honda Civic Genio bekas is no exception. Knowing about the common problems can help you spot potential issues before they become major headaches. One frequent issue is rust, particularly in areas prone to moisture and salt exposure. Surabaya's climate can exacerbate this, so regular washing and waxing are essential. If you spot rust, address it promptly to prevent it from spreading. Sanding, treating, and repainting the affected areas can help keep your Genio looking its best. Another common problem is wear and tear on the suspension. Over time, the shocks, struts, and bushings can degrade, leading to a bumpy ride and poor handling. If you notice excessive bouncing or swaying, it's time to have your suspension inspected. Replacing worn components can significantly improve your car's ride quality and safety. Engine issues can also arise, especially in older Genios. Problems like oil leaks, worn piston rings, and faulty sensors can affect performance and fuel economy. Regular maintenance, including oil changes, tune-ups, and timely repairs, can help keep your engine running smoothly. If you notice any unusual noises, smells, or warning lights, don't ignore them. Get your car checked out by a qualified mechanic as soon as possible. Electrical problems are another potential concern. The Genio's electrical system is relatively simple, but issues like faulty wiring, corroded connections, and failing sensors can still occur. If you experience problems with your lights, wipers, or other electrical components, start by checking the fuses and connections. If that doesn't solve the problem, you may need to consult a professional. Transmission issues can also crop up, especially in automatic models. Slipping gears, rough shifting, and unusual noises can indicate a problem with the transmission. Regular fluid changes and proper maintenance can help extend the life of your transmission. If you suspect a problem, have it diagnosed and repaired promptly to avoid further damage. Brake problems are also something to watch out for. Worn brake pads, rotors, and calipers can compromise your car's stopping power. If you notice squealing, grinding, or a soft brake pedal, it's time to have your brakes inspected. Replacing worn components and flushing the brake fluid can ensure your brakes are functioning properly. Addressing these common problems promptly can help you keep your Honda Civic Genio bekas in top condition. Regular maintenance, careful inspection, and timely repairs are key to enjoying your classic ride for years to come.

    Maintenance Tips for Your Civic Genio

    Keeping your Honda Civic Genio bekas running smoothly requires consistent care and attention. Regular maintenance not only extends the life of your car but also ensures it remains a reliable and enjoyable ride. So, what are the essential maintenance tips you should follow? First, stick to a regular oil change schedule. Oil is the lifeblood of your engine, and changing it regularly helps keep everything lubricated and running smoothly. Check your owner's manual for the recommended interval, but generally, every 3,000 to 5,000 miles is a good rule of thumb. Using high-quality oil and filters can also make a difference. Next, keep an eye on your coolant levels. Coolant helps regulate your engine's temperature and prevents overheating. Check the coolant level regularly and top it off as needed. It's also a good idea to flush and replace the coolant every few years to prevent corrosion and buildup. Check your tires regularly. Proper tire pressure is essential for good handling, fuel economy, and tire life. Use a tire pressure gauge to check the pressure and inflate your tires to the recommended level. Also, inspect your tires for wear and tear, and rotate them regularly to ensure even wear. Inspect your brakes regularly. Your brakes are crucial for safety, so it's important to keep them in good condition. Check the brake pads, rotors, and calipers for wear and tear. If you notice any squealing, grinding, or a soft brake pedal, have your brakes inspected by a professional. Replace your air filter regularly. A clean air filter helps your engine breathe easier and improves fuel economy. Check your air filter regularly and replace it when it's dirty or clogged. Keep your car clean. Washing and waxing your car regularly not only keeps it looking good but also protects the paint from the elements. Pay attention to areas prone to rust, and address any spots promptly. Check your fluids regularly. In addition to oil and coolant, you should also check your brake fluid, power steering fluid, and transmission fluid. Top off as needed and replace them according to the manufacturer's recommendations. Inspect your belts and hoses. Belts and hoses can crack and deteriorate over time, leading to leaks and other problems. Inspect them regularly and replace them when they show signs of wear.     Finding the Best Deals in Surabaya

    Alright, you're ready to buy, but where do you find the best deals on a Honda Civic Genio bekas in Surabaya? Finding the right car at the right price takes some effort, but it's definitely achievable. Let's explore some strategies to help you snag a great deal. First, explore online marketplaces. Websites like OLX, Mobil123, and Carmudi are popular platforms for buying and selling used cars in Indonesia. These sites offer a wide selection of Genios, and you can easily filter your search by price, location, and other criteria. Take your time to browse through the listings, and don't be afraid to contact sellers with questions. Next, visit local used car dealerships. Surabaya has many used car dealerships that specialize in selling a variety of vehicles. Visiting these dealerships can give you a chance to see multiple Genios in person and compare prices and conditions. Be sure to negotiate the price and ask about any warranties or guarantees. Check social media groups and forums. Facebook groups and online forums dedicated to car enthusiasts can be great resources for finding deals. Join groups that focus on Honda Civic Genios or used cars in Surabaya. You might find sellers who are looking to sell their cars directly, cutting out the middleman and potentially saving you money. Attend local car auctions. Car auctions can be a great way to find deals on used cars, including the Genio. Keep an eye out for local car auctions in Surabaya and attend a few to get a sense of the process. Be prepared to do your research beforehand and set a budget. Consider buying from private sellers. Buying directly from a private seller can sometimes result in a better deal, as they may be more motivated to sell and less likely to inflate the price. However, be sure to exercise caution and thoroughly inspect the car before making a purchase. Negotiate the price. Don't be afraid to negotiate the price with the seller. Do your research to determine the fair market value of the car, and use that as a starting point for your negotiations. Point out any flaws or issues with the car to justify a lower price. Get a pre-purchase inspection. Before you finalize the deal, it's always a good idea to get a pre-purchase inspection from a trusted mechanic.
